Candidates for municipal office in Kingfisher County municipalities may file declarations of candidacy beginning at 8 a.m. Monday, Feb. 1.

Shawna Butts, Kingfisher County Election Board secretary, said the filing period ends at 5 p.m. Wednesday, Feb. 3.

Declarations of candidacy will be accepted at the county election board office for each of the municipalities, Monday through Wednesday from 8 a.m.-5p.m.

If you come to the office after 4:30 p.m., please use the southeast entrance door. Call the office at (405) 375-3895 if you have any problems.

The municipal offices at stake in Kingfisher County will be filled in the nonpartisan election scheduled April 6 and include the following:

Town of Hennessey

Two town trustees, with four-year terms of office, ending April 2025.

Town treasurer, with a four-year term ending April 2025.

Town clerk, two-year unexpired term ending April 2023.

Town of Okarche

Town trustee, Ward 2, four-year term expiring in 2025.

Town trustee, Ward 3, four-year unexpired term ending in 2023.

Town treasurer, four-year term expiring in 2025.

Town of Dover

Two trustees, with four-year terms expiring in 2025.

City of Kingfisher

City commissioner, four-year term at large, expiring in 2025.
